Adventure Projects consists of seven challenges to plan and build ways
to survive a ship wreck near atropical island. Each student group
must complete a journal and a LEGOCAD rendering of their model.
The
seven challenges are: #1: Salvage, #2: Shelter, #3:
Water,
#4: Food, #5: Signal, #6: Transportation, #7:
Rescue.
Students are also encouraged to draw a picture of their model and
explain
how it accomplishes the goals set, and how it aids the ship wrecked
islanders
to survive until they are rescued.
The first challenge for
the victims is to salvage the items on board the ship while reaching
the
island nearby before the ship actually submerged under the ocean.
Time is short, so this design will allow the victims to get to the
island
along with many of the ship parts and supplies. Notice that the
crane
will allow items to be moved onto the raft and the motor will power it
away from the sinking ship. The extra weight on the rear of the
deck
will steady the raft with its cargo.

|

The crane is pulled up to make the raft
more
sea worthy. It can be lowered again closer to the island.
